Which of the following inequalities is always true for any real number \('a'\) and \('b'?\)

A. \(|a + b| = |a| + |b|\)
B. \(|a + b| > |a| + |b|\)
C. \(|a + b| \leq |a| + |b|\)
D. \(|a - b| \leq |a| - |b|\)
E. \(|a - b| > |a| - |b|\)

The OA is C
